Rewrite null checks in read barrier introspection thunks.
Rely on the implicit null check in the fast path.
Test: Manual; run-test --gdb 160, break in the introspection
entrypoint, find the mf.testField0000 read barrier
code in the caller (this one has a stack map for null
check, most other reads do not need one), break there,
step into the thunk, overwrite the base register with
0 and observe the NPE being thrown. Repeat with --64.
Test: Pixel 2 XL boots.
Test: testrunner.py --target --optimizing
